Hello there, as a dental health enthusiast with a keen interest in the ingredients that contribute to oral care, I'm excited to share my insights on toothpaste brands that are rich in xylitol. Xylitol is a natural sweetener that has been widely recognized for its beneficial effects on dental health, particularly in reducing the risk of tooth decay. It's a sugar alcohol that can't be fermented by bacteria in the mouth, which means it doesn't contribute to the production of acids that lead to cavities.

When it comes to choosing a toothpaste with the most xylitol, it's important to consider not just the quantity but also the quality of the xylitol used and the overall formulation of the toothpaste. Let's delve into some of the brands that are known for their xylitol content:

1. **Xlear Spry Cinnamon Toothpaste (with fluoride)**: This brand boasts a 25% xylitol content, which is quite substantial. Xylitol is the first ingredient listed, indicating a high concentration that can effectively support oral health.


2. CariFree CTx3 Gel: Another brand that doesn't shy away from using xylitol in generous amounts, CariFree CTx3 Gel also contains 25% xylitol. This gel is designed to provide a protective barrier against bacteria and is fluoride-free, catering to those who prefer a fluoride-free option.


3. CariFree CTx4 Gel (contains fluoride): Similar to its fluoride-free counterpart, the CTx4 Gel from CariFree contains an equally impressive 25% xylitol. The addition of fluoride makes it a more traditional option for those who believe in the cavity-fighting benefits of fluoride.

4. **Natural Dentist Health Teeth & Gums Toothpaste**: While not as high in xylitol content as the previous brands, this toothpaste still offers a decent 10% xylitol. It's a natural option that also focuses on overall oral health, not just cavity prevention.
